Omar Abdullah to address three key rallies in Jammu region on Sept 27

JAMMU: National Conference Vice President and former Chief Minister, Omar Abdullah will address three major public rallies in the Jammu region on Friday, September 27, 2024, as part of his extensive campaign for the upcoming Assembly elections.

The rallies will take place in Udhampur East, Vijaypur, and Jammu North constituencies, where Omar Abdullah will outline the party’s vision and commitment to the people of Jammu and Kashmir.

Omar Abdullah’s first rally will be held at HD Palace in Dehma, Block Khoon, Udhampur East (Constituency No. 60) at 11:30 am in support of JKNC candidate for Udhampur East, Sunil Verma.

Following this, the second rally will be conducted at Aureum Grand Hotel in Thandi Khui, Vijaypur (Constituency No. 71) at 2:00 Pm in support of Rajesh Pargotra, JKNC candidate for Vijaypur Assembly constituency. This gathering is expected to focus on the local concerns of the Vijaypur region and the party’s efforts to address the ongoing challenges faced by the people.

The final rally will take place in Jammu North (Constituency No. 79) at Thathar, near Radha Swami Ashram at 3:30 Pm in support of NC candidate Ajay Kumar Sadhotra for Jammu North Assembly segment.

These rallies mark an important phase in the National Conference’s campaign strategy, as Omar Abdullah aims to directly connect with the electorate, offering solutions for regional challenges and reiterating the party’s commitment to restoring the dignity and special status of Jammu and Kashmir.
